According to Avian and Exotic Animal Care + Hospital, chameleons are mainly insect eaters, but many, especially veiled chameleons, will eat some leafy greens like collard greens, kale, mustard greens, and dandelion greens.Some adult chameleons will even accept the occasional pinkie mouse. There are more than 160 species of chameleons native to a wide area from sub-Saharan Africa through southern Europe, the Middle East, southern India, Sri Lanka, some islands in the Indian Ocean and Madagascar. I dust the insects twice a month before feeding them to the chameleons with a vitamin powder that contains a beta carotene source of Vitamin A. Chameleons are found in tropical and mountain rain forests, savannas and some deserts and steppes. Chameleon species in captivity who like to eat vegetables can eat acorn squash, butternut squash, bell peppers, pumpkin, okra, sweet potato, zucchini, and cucumber, to name a few. And I dust the insects with a phosphorous-free Calcium/D3 powder twice a month because my chameleons rarely get direct sunlight. To keep their colors bright, chameleons need to eat a diet that is primarily comprised of insects, but it can be balanced out with a few select fruits and vegetables. Larval insects like mealworms and waxworms contain very little calcium and should only be offered in limited quantities and rarely.
